The confident CO at home

At Pierre-Fabre, Castres has the 7th best record in the Top14 this season (5 wins, 2 losses).

20:56

The Castres want their revenge

During the first leg at Mayol, the RCT largely won, 41-19, after an offensive festival and 7 tries scored.

The CO to get closer to the RCT

Castres (8th, 35 points) hosts Toulon (5th, 37 points) at Pierre-Fabre this Sunday evening. In the event of a victory, the Castres will overtake the RCT in the standings to come within one point of Racing (4th). For their part, Pierre Mignoni’s players could join Bordeaux-Bègles (3rd, 41 points) and the podium in the event of a victory in Tarn.
